Product Overview: Texas Instruments OPA350EA/2K5G4
The Texas Instruments OPA350EA/2K5G4 is a high-performance, precision operational amplifier (op-amp) that offers a perfect blend of speed and precision for a wide range of applications. This op-amp is part of the OPA350 series, which are rail-to-rail, high-speed, CMOS operational amplifiers optimized for low-voltage, single-supply operation, making them ideal for battery-powered and portable applications.
Key Features
- High-Speed Performance: The OPA350EA/2K5G4 boasts a slew rate of 5 V/μs and a bandwidth of 38 MHz, which makes it suitable for fast signal processing applications.
- Low Noise: With a low noise density of 8 nV/√Hz, this op-amp provides clean amplification, crucial for precision instrumentation and sensitive signal acquisition.
- Rail-to-Rail Output: The ability to swing outputs from rail to rail maximizes the dynamic range in single-supply applications.
- Low Input Bias Current: The input bias current is as low as 1 pA, which is beneficial for high-impedance sources and precision applications.
- Single-Supply Operation: Designed for a supply voltage range of 2.7 V to 5.5 V, the OPA350EA/2K5G4 is versatile in various circuit configurations.
- Power-Saving Shutdown Mode: An optional shutdown mode allows the user to reduce power consumption when the amplifier is not in use.
